About the role

Responsibilities

  • Oversee daily financial aid operations including application review, verification, packaging, and disbursement
  • Ensure compliance with Title IV federal, state, and accreditor regulations
  • Counsel students and families on financial aid options, eligibility, and borrower responsibilities
  • Manage financial aid systems and ensure data integrity within the student information system (SIS)
  • Supervise, train, and evaluate financial aid staff
  • Prepare for internal audits and federal program reviews

Requirements

  • Associate's degree in a related field (Bachelor's preferred)
  • 3–5+ years of experience in postsecondary financial aid administration
  • Demonstrated knowledge of Title IV federal financial aid programs and regulations
  • Hands-on experience with COD, NSLDS, EdExpress, and EdConnect
  • Experience with financial aid management systems and SIS
  • Proven experience supervising and developing staff

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ience at a private, for-profit, or career-focused institution
  • Familiarity with California state aid programs (CSAC - Cal Grant)
  • Experience with Veteran Administration (VA) benefits and serving as a School Certifying Official (SCO)

Benefits

  • Paid Sick Leave: 40 hours per calendar year
  • Paid Vacation: 40 hours in the first year; 80 hours annually from the second year
  • Paid Holidays: 8 paid holidays per calendar year
  • Health Insurance: PPO and HMO options with premium coverage up to $400/month
  • 401(k): Eligible after one year and 1,000 hours of service
